Chrissy Wallace joins The Also-Ran Broadcast with special guest Jeremy Mayfield to discuss the hot start for D2 Motorsports, recent victories in Super Cup competition, and the chemistry that has helped the team become one of the most talked-about programs in short track racing. The conversation also introduces young racer Annaston Bush, whose impressive drive through the field at Lonesome Pine Raceway caught the attention of both Wallace and Mayfield. From breaking track records to mentoring the next generation of racers, this episode dives deep into grassroots motorsports, the future of women in racing, and why short track racing still delivers some of the best competition in America.

What's History Worth? Why Greenville Pickens is Worth MORE than Paper & Coin | Tasha Porter Kummer

Tasha Porter Kummer joins the Also-Ran Broadcast to discuss the ongoing fight to save Greenville Pickens Speedway. In this episode, we dive into the history of the legendary South Carolina short track, the ownership struggles that led to its decline, the recent surge of community support, and how racers, fans, and even NASCAR personalities are stepping up to help preserve the speedway. We also talk about: Dale Earnhardt Jr.’s involvement Council meetings and local politics Why social media changed everything The future of Greenville Pickens Speedway How fans can help keep the track alive For anyone passionate about grassroots racing, NASCAR history, and the future of short track racing, this is an episode you won’t want to miss.

Willy T. Ribbs: Indy 500 Trailblazer & Racing Pioneer

Willy T. Ribbs joins the Also Ran Broadcast to share unforgettable stories from one of the most groundbreaking careers in motorsports history. From becoming the first Black driver to qualify for the Indianapolis 500 to racing against legends like Mario Andretti, Emerson Fittipaldi, Al Unser Jr., and Nigel Mansell, Willy takes us deep into the world of IndyCar, Formula racing, IMSA, NASCAR, and Trans-Am competition. He discusses: His path to the Indy 500 Racing for Dan Gurney and Toyota Formula 1 dreams and racing in England The danger and intensity of IndyCar in the 1990s NASCAR politics and his Truck Series experience Advice from Bobby Unser and racing’s old-school legends What it really takes to compete at the highest level This episode is packed with racing history, behind-the-scenes stories, and honest insight from one of motorsports’ true pioneers.
